Dickey 1996-2002 * 31 ****************************************************************************/ 32 33#include <curses.priv.h> 34 35MODULE_ID("$Id: wresize.c,v 1.23 2002/09/28 15:15:51 tom Exp $") 36 37static int 38cleanup_lines(struct ldat *data, int length) 39{ 40 while (--length >= 0) 41 free(data->text); 42 free(data); 43 return ERR; 44} 45 46/* 47 * If we have reallocated the ldat structs, we will have to repair pointers 48 * used in subwindows. 49 */ 50static void 51repair_subwindows(WINDOW *cmp) 52{ 53 WINDOWLIST *wp; 54 struct ldat *pline = cmp->_line; 55 int row; 56 57 for (wp = _nc_windows; wp != 0; wp = wp->next) { 58 WINDOW *tst = &(wp->win); 59 60 if (tst->_parent == cmp) { 61 62 if (tst->_pary > cmp->_maxy) 63 tst->_pary = cmp->_maxy; 64 if (tst->_parx > cmp->_maxx) 65 tst->_parx = cmp->_maxx; 66 67 if (tst->_maxy + tst->_pary > cmp->_maxy) 68 tst->_maxy = cmp->_maxy - tst->_pary; 69 if (tst->_maxx + tst->_parx > cmp->_maxx) 70 tst->_maxx = cmp->_maxx - tst->_parx; 71 72 for (row = 0; row <= tst->_maxy; ++row) { 73 tst->_line[row].text = &pline[tst->_pary + row].text[tst->_parx]; 74 } 75 repair_subwindows(tst); 76 } 77 } 78} 79 80/* 81 * Reallocate a curses WINDOW struct to either shrink or grow to the specified 82 * new lines/columns. If it grows, the new character cells are filled with 83 * blanks. The application is responsible for repainting the blank area. 84 */ 85NCURSES_EXPORT(int) 86wresize(WINDOW *win, int ToLines, int ToCols) 87{ 88 int col, row, size_x, size_y; 89 struct ldat *pline; 90 struct ldat *new_lines = 0; 91 92#ifdef TRACE 93 T((T_CALLED("wresize(%p,%d,%d)"), win, ToLines, ToCols)); 94 if (win) { 95 TR(TRACE_UPDATE, ("...beg (%d, %d), max(%d,%d), reg(%d,%d)", 96 win->_begy, win->_begx, 97 win->_maxy, win->_maxx, 98 win->_regtop, win->_regbottom)); 99 if (_nc_tracing & TRACE_UPDATE) 100 _tracedump("...before", win); 101 } 102#endif 103 104 if (!win || --ToLines < 0 || --ToCols < 0) 105 returnCode(ERR); 106 107 size_x = win->_maxx; 108 size_y = win->_maxy; 109 110 if (ToLines == size_y 111 && ToCols == size_x) 112 returnCode(OK); 113 114 if ((win->_flags & _SUBWIN)) { 115 /* 116 * Check if the new limits will fit into the parent window's size. If 117 * not, do not resize. We could adjust the location of the subwindow, 118 * but the application may not like that. 119 */ 120 if (win->_pary + ToLines > win->_parent->_maxy 121 || win->_parx + ToCols > win->_parent->_maxx) { 122 returnCode(ERR); 123 } 124 pline = win->_parent->_line; 125 } else { 126 pline = 0; 127 } 128 129 /* 130 * Allocate new memory as needed. Do the allocations without modifying 131 * the original window, in case an allocation fails. Always allocate 132 * (at least temporarily) the array pointing to the individual lines. 133 */ 134 new_lines = typeCalloc(struct ldat, (unsigned) (ToLines + 1)); 135 if (new_lines == 0) 136 returnCode(ERR); 137 138 /* 139 * For each line in the target, allocate or adjust pointers for the 140 * corresponding text, depending on whether this is a window or a 141 * subwindow. 142 */ 143 for (row = 0; row <= ToLines; ++row) { 144 int begin = (row > size_y) ? 0 : (size_x + 1); 145 int end = ToCols; 146 NCURSES_CH_T *s; 147 148 if (!(win->_flags & _SUBWIN)) { 149 if (row <= size_y) { 150 if (ToCols != size_x) { 151 if ((s = typeMalloc(NCURSES_CH_T, ToCols + 1)) == 0) 152 returnCode(cleanup_lines(new_lines, row)); 153 for (col = 0; col <= ToCols; ++col) { 154 s[col] = (col <= size_x 155 ? win->_line[row].text[col] 156 : win->_nc_bkgd); 157 } 158 } else { 159 s = win->_line[row].text; 160 } 161 } else { 162 if ((s = typeMalloc(NCURSES_CH_T, ToCols + 1)) == 0) 163 returnCode(cleanup_lines(new_lines, row)); 164 for (col = 0; col <= ToCols; ++col) 165 s[col] = win->_nc_bkgd; 166 } 167 } else { 168 s = &pline[win->_pary + row].text[win->_parx]; 169 } 170 171 if_USE_SCROLL_HINTS(new_lines[row].oldindex = row); 172 if (row <= size_y) { 173 new_lines[row].firstchar = win->_line[row].firstchar; 174 new_lines[row].lastchar = win->_line[row].lastchar; 175 } 176 if ((ToCols != size_x) || (row > size_y)) { 177 if (end >= begin) { /* growing */ 178 if (new_lines[row].firstchar < begin) 179 new_lines[row].firstchar = begin; 180 } else { /* shrinking */ 181 new_lines[row].firstchar = 0; 182 } 183 new_lines[row].lastchar = ToCols; 184 } 185 new_lines[row].text = s; 186 } 187 188 /* 189 * Dispose of unwanted memory. 190 */ 191 if (!(win->_flags & _SUBWIN)) { 192 if (ToCols == size_x) { 193 for (row = ToLines + 1; row <= size_y; row++) { 194 free(win->_line[row].text); 195 } 196 } else { 197 for (row = 0; row <= size_y; row++) { 198 free(win->_line[row].text); 199 } 200 } 201 } 202 203 free(win->_line); 204 win->_line = new_lines; 205 206 /* 207 * Finally, adjust the parameters showing screen size and cursor 208 * position: 209 */ 210 win->_maxx = ToCols; 211 win->_maxy = ToLines; 212 213 if (win->_regtop > win->_maxy) 214 win->_regtop = win->_maxy; 215 if (win->_regbottom > win->_maxy 216 || win->_regbottom == size_y) 217 win->_regbottom = win->_maxy; 218 219 if (win->_curx > win->_maxx) 220 win->_curx = win->_maxx; 221 if (win->_cury > win->_maxy) 222 win->_cury = win->_maxy; 223 224 /* 225 * Check for subwindows of this one, and readjust pointers to our text, 226 * if needed. 227 */ 228 repair_subwindows(win); 229 230#ifdef TRACE 231 TR(TRACE_UPDATE, ("...beg (%d, %d), max(%d,%d), reg(%d,%d)", 232 win->_begy, win->_begx, 233 win->_maxy, win->_maxx, 234 win->_regtop, win->_regbottom)); 235 if (_nc_tracing & TRACE_UPDATE) 236 _tracedump("...after:", win); 237#endif 238 returnCode(OK); 239} 240
